Delivering an integrated approach to safety: How AWS workforce safety solutions make work safer

Internet of Things Blog



This article discusses the importance of an integrated approach to workforce safety and how AWS provides solutions to enable this. It covers key trends driving companies to adopt integrated safety measures, challenges faced in different industries, and how AWS is building safety into its core operations through a unified approach to workforce safety starting with prevention through design.

Specifically, the article covers:

  • Safety trends and challenges across industries like construction, manufacturing, and semiconductor
  • The need for a unified safety blueprint integrating various data sources and technologies like IoT, computer vision, AI/ML, and VR
  • AWS Workforce Safety solutions enabling a modular yet unified approach, with use cases like safety pattern monitoring, hazard detection, centralized reporting, and virtual training
  • Solution guidance from AWS on data ingestion, streaming, processing, and visualization for workforce safety
  • Amazon's implementation of prevention through design using AWS IoT TwinMaker and Matterport's digital twins to identify and address potential safety hazards
  • Conclusion emphasizing the benefits of an integrated approach and the role of technologies like digital twins
